The Move

I think sometimes that my life is like a great rock in the desert that just won’t move, no matter how much muscle I apply to move it.

Call it a dilemma, a pain, a bad memory, a sin, a hurt inflicted on me, and so on – whatever the struggle, I just can’t get it out of my life. The rock of the impasse before me won’t budge.

So, instead of muscling up to move it, I do what I can with my hands… and let go.

This is what I’m learning right now. To let go. Let go of the great rock weighting me down.

I spend so much wasted energy trying to solve the mysteries of life by thinking I can move the rock, when the answer is to let God and His divine glory be mysterious, and to worship Him in awe.

And, in humility, with courage, simply let the rock be God’s, and move on by.
